Taxonomic Classification

Rank Coolabah Apple Mountain Tapir
Kingdom Plantae (Plants) Animalia (Animals)
Phylum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) Chordata (Chordates)
Class Magnoliopsida (Dicots) Mammalia (Mammals)
Order Myrtales (Myrtales) Perissodactyla (Odd-toed Ungulates)
Family Myrtaceae Tapiridae
Genus Angophora Tapirus
Species Angophora melanoxylon Tapirus pinchaque
